From 23 September to 11 November 2017, the CWC Gallery in Berlin presents the most extensive exhibition dedicated to the former supermodel so far.
From 23 September, the CWC Gallery in Berlin presents the group exhibition Claudia Schiffer. The selection of 100 photographs is the most extensive showcase dedicated to Schiffer’s modelling career to date.

The exhibition pays tribute not only to the German supermodel herself, but also her collaboration with the world’s most acclaimed photography artists. This year Schiffer, who was first discovered at 17, celebrates 30 years in the world of modelling. Her earliest photographs, taken by Ellen von Unwerth, catapulted Schiffer to international fame and brought her to the attention of leading fashion designers.

Spanning the period from the late 1980s to 2011, the exhibited works include excerpts from well-known fashion campaigns as well as portraits and nudes. Among the 15 represented photography artists are Ellen von Unwerth, Miles Aldridge, Herb Ritts and Camilla Akrans.
